Jayson Holt Wells was born June 26, 1971 in Ardmore, OK. Two days later he was "selected" and became the son of Steve and Penny Wells. There he experienced a childhood where he loved his family and was loved and adored by his parents, sister, grandparents, and aunts and uncles.

Jayson attended Franklin Elementary and was remembered there for his acapella rendition of Kenny Rogers "The Gambler". He graduated from Ardmore High School in the class of 1989. He later attended and graduated from Missouri Southern University in December of 2000 with a degree in Business Administration. Jayson's mental ability allowed him to pass any test he ever tried and remembered facts and figures that many could not even recall hearing about. This ability allowed him to always remember the perfect gift that you wanted, even when you didn't remember expressing it to anyone.

He was baptized by Richard Hopper at the First Baptist Church in Ardmore, Oklahoma on May 26, 1981 and attended Sunday school class and went to Falls Creek as well as going on mission trips with the other youth.

Jayson passed and was a journeyman plumber as well as a licensed commercial truck driver. He worked for various employers in the Ardmore area.

Jayson left to be with his Lord and eternal family on November 9 th , 2021.

Jayson was preceded in death by his grandparents J.V. and Alta Wells and Hoyle and Arlene Holt as well as his aunts Becky Holt and Carol Harrell.

He is survived by his parents Steve and Penny Wells; sister Julie Pino and her fiance Reed Holden; niece Isabella Pino and nephews Gunner, Cruz, and  Gage Pino; uncle Greg and aunt Eva Wells; uncle Paul Harrell; cousins Keaton and Natalie Wells and Amber Freeman.

He loved to travel and would always do so to see an eclipse in Kentucky or to attend the next Phish concert.

Jayson was somewhat of a Trekkie and would likely have wanted his parting remark to be "Live long and prosper".

A memorial service is scheduled for Monday, November 15 th at 11:00 a.m. at the First United Methodist Church of Ardmore with the Rev. David Daniel officiating. Visitation will be Sunday afternoon from 4 to 5:00 p.m. at Craddock Funeral Home.
